Context for future maintainers: the spreadsheet export path in Tallowmere Reports used to buffer entire workbooks in memory, which caused OOM kills on tenants with more than ~200k rows. I migrated the writer to a streaming approach with a fixed 64 MB buffer; the remaining hotspot is the styles cache, which still grows with distinct cell formats. Profiling notes and heap snapshots are linked in the runbook. As of this handover, ongoing ownership of the memory work passes to the person named below.

named custodian: Oliath Ralax

Subject: DR drill recap — per-tenant quotas

Hey folks, quick note before the weekly sync: Wednesday's drill went fine-ish. Failing over Quotaline to the Marrow Bay region worked, but per-tenant rate quotas reset to defaults, which annoyed two big tenants on Pelton's list. Fix is queued. One action item: the quota snapshot vault needs manual unsealing after failover, so use the passphrase below.

recovery phrase for fahap-haduf: casvan-eliius-novmir-holiel-oliwyn-brivan-gilax-gilael-gilax-wenius-rusael-istius-ralys-julwyn

Document Transport — Print Shop Master Copies

Quick guide for moving master copies to Bramblehurst Print Co. These are the only originals, so treat the run like a valuables transfer, not a regular parcel drop. Use the red tamper-evident envelopes from the supply shelf, log the seal number in the transport book, and never combine the run with general mail. The masters go directly to the press supervisor, nobody else. On arrival, the courier must follow the hand-over instruction stated below.

drop instructions, kajep-tageg: the kasvan casdor courier leaves the quenvan quenox druox ledger at gate 4316 under passcode 799004

Eng sync notes: the Pondwick markdown pipeline is finally streaming — chunks render as they parse, so big docs no longer block the UI. Footnote handling still has an edge case with nested lists; fix lands next sprint. Sanitizer pass stays synchronous for now. Bugs or perf weirdness should go straight to the pipeline owner below.

account owner for bawip-tahag: Raleth Quenok